Eight sporopollen zones have been dividedbased on the results of high-resolution sporopollen analysisof Core B10 in the southern Yellow Sea. Based on the resultsalong with ~(14)C datings and the subbottom profiling data,climatic and environmental changes since the last stage oflate Pleistocene are discussed. The main conclusions aredrawn as follows: (1) the vegetation evolved in the process ofconiferous forest-grassland containing broad-leaved trees -coniferous and broad-leaved mixed forest→coniferous andbroad-leaved mixed forest-grassland prevailed by coniferoustrees →coniferous and broad-leaved mixed forest-grasslandcontaining evergreen broad-leaved trees→coniferous andbroad-leaved mixed forest-grassland prevailed by broad-leaved trees →deciduous broad-leaved forest-meadow con-taining evergreen broad-leaved trees→coniferous and broad-leaved mixed forest-grassland prevailed by broad-leavedtrees → coniferous and broad-leaved mixed forest containingevergreen broad-leaved trees; (2) eight stages of climatechanges are identified as the cold and dry stage, the temper-ate and wet stage, the cold and dry stage, the warm and drystage, the temperate and wet stage, the hot and dry stage, thetemperate and dry stage, then the warm and dry stage inturn; (3) the sedimentary environment developed from land,to littoral zone, to land again, then to shore-neritic zone; and(4) the Yellow Sea Warm Current formed during early-Holocene rather than Atlantic stage.
